What are the must-see historical sites and other places in Holborn?
Holborn is notable for landmarks like Peacock Theatre, Novello Theatre and Honourable Society of Lincoln’s Inn. Known for its theatres and museums, cultural venues include Theatreland, Sir John Soane’s Museum and Hunterian Museum. Additionally, in the area, you’ll find The British Museum and Trafalgar Square.
What is a historic hotel like in Holborn?
When you book a historic hotel, you’ll enjoy a holiday in a building that has a national historic designation. A palace, castle, grand home or even an old police station, pub, lodge or skyscraper can be transformed into a historic hotel provided that it’s a place of special interest. Traditional architecture and period features are often found in the communal spaces and guestrooms of such hotels in Holborn, giving a real sense of character.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
“Heritage hotel” is a term often used in Asia and Europe, while “historic hotel” is a term often used in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and building of historic hotels tend to be the most significant aspect. For a heritage hotel, it’s mainly the cultural value as well as how it influenced the community.
